This paper analyses the planning and control process in the application of resources developed by the executive branches of twelve municipalities in the north-western region of the state of Rio Grande do Sul. It discusses public planning in Brazil, emphasising the legal aspects and the need for planning, control and evaluation by public administrators, through planning instruments such as the PPA, LDO and LOA. A bibliographical review of the Fiscal Responsibility Law, Strategic Planning and Management Control was also presented. The results obtained from the data analysis are presented, showing an assessment of the context of planning and control in the realisation and application of public resources, identifying the main deviations that occur in the budget, due to not using it as a planning and control tool. It was concluded that there is inefficiency in planning and even the non-existence of this practice in some cases, hence the need for an alternative management control system that proposes continuous monitoring of planning and adequate and consistent management control.
